Reducing NOx emissions from over 180 mg/Nm³ to below 90 mg/Nm³ – without replacing the entire plant. That was the challenge at the 3M site in Hilden, Germany. The existing boiler system, equipped with SG-80 burners, had been in operation for more than 40 years and no longer met the requirements of the 44th BImSchV. Instead of installing a completely new system, the approach focused on targeted modernization: ✅ Optimization of the existing burner components ✅ Step-by-step evaluation of emission reduction potential ✅ Implementation of flue gas recirculation (FGR) The result: NOx emissions were reduced to well below the required limit – ensuring compliance and enabling continued operation of the existing system. What makes this project particularly relevant: It shows that even older installations can be adapted to current regulations with the right approach – often with significantly lower investment and effort. 👉 Read the full project here: https://lnkd.in/edvc4cNA
